河北建站科技网络公司网站关键词seo费用
2026/1/10 9:10:15 网站建设 项目流程
河北建站科技网络公司,网站关键词seo费用,如何做网站结构及栏目策划,人力资源培训与开发MobX 内部原理深度解析 1. ComputedValue 特性 1.1 只读特性 ComputedValue 通常是只读的,因为它的 setter 没有明确的定义。它不依赖于 Atom,在 reportObserved() 方法上采用了不同的实现方式,建立了可观察对象和观察者之间的联系,这与 Atom 内部的行为一致。以购物车…MobX 内部原理深度解析1. ComputedValue 特性1.1 只读特性ComputedValue 通常是只读的,因为它的 setter 没有明确的定义。它不依赖于 Atom,在reportObserved()方法上采用了不同的实现方式,建立了可观察对象和观察者之间的联系,这与 Atom 内部的行为一致。以购物车描述为例,它是一个从其他可观察对象(如商品和优惠券)生成字符串的计算值,为其设置 setter 几乎是不可能的,因为需要解析字符串并得到商品和优惠券的值。所以,一般将 ComputedValue 视为只读的可观察对象。1.2 依赖计算ComputedValue 的值计算是依赖于其他可观察对象的副作用,MobX 将这种计算称为派生(derivation)。它是依赖的可观察对象发生变化时的结果。ComputedValue 是依赖树中唯一既是可观察对象又是观察者的节点,它的值是可观察的,同时由于依赖其他可观察对象,它也是一个观察者。具体关系如下:| 类型 | 特点 || ---- | ---- || ObservableValue | 仅为可观察对象 || Reaction | 仅为观察者 || ComputedValue | 既是可观察对象又是观察者 |1.3 高效计算ComputedValue 的派生函数可能是一个开销较大的操作,因此 MobX 采用了一系列优化措施来实现懒加载:- 除非明确请求或有依赖于该 ComputedValue 的反应,否则不会计算其值。当没有观察者时,

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询